《能效2025》是国际能源署(IEA)一项针对全球能效进展的重要年度分析报告,梳理总结了全球在能源强度、能源需求,以及能效投资、就业和政策方面的近期趋势。报告对工业、建筑、家电和交通各部门进行了具体分析,并探讨了碳减排、能源安全、可负担性和竞争力等系统层面的专题。本报告与IEA“能效进展跟踪”数据库(Energy Efficiency Progress Tracker)的最新一期更新同时发布,通过IEA官网可直接对其进行访问。

Global efficiency progress sees improvement in 2025
Preliminary estimates show an improvement in global energy efficiency
progress to 1.8% in 2025, up from 1% in 2024, with particularly strong progress in key
regions in Asia
2025 also saw strong policy action
Policy making is accelerating in many areas with over 250 new or updated policies in 2025, in countries accounting for 85% of global energy demand. In particular, governments enacted efficiency policies this year to address global energy policy priorities, including energy security, affordability and competitiveness
But the world remains off track
Average progress in recent years remains well below the global doubling target agreed at COP28
